Visited to dine numerous times in the past 3 years. I've never been disappointed, the service is always very friendly, the pizzas are always very well done and the ingredients are of great quality. The drinks and sweets are also great. Coffee is a + too. Clean and tidy, both the kitchen and the dining area. The tram from Porta Venezia stops close by so it's easy to reach via public transport, if driving there you will find some parking bays where you can pay and park but the majority are resident only bays so I'd recommend public transport to reach them. Location has both an inside dining area and an ample terrace outside should the weather be nice enough. Pizza is very hard to judge as everyone has particular taste and expectations when it comes to pizza, in my opinion, this is how pizza should be, amazing. Service is quick, being seated, taking your order, cooking and paying, everything is well organised and quick. Definitely worth a visit.

Great lunch offer at Pizzium: a pizza of the day or another main or salad, 1/2 l of bottle water and espresso for 10 euro. Pizza are Napoli style (puffed edge and a bit charred), very big. The two of us shared a pizza (Valle d’Aoste, pictured) and a salad with burrata. Excellent pizza dough, not too thin, not too thick, not too crusty, not too gummy: the perfect bite. The tomato sauce is so fresh tasting, like eating tomatoes off the vine ! Nice, homey decor, cute plates. Was surprised to learn this is a chain of restaurants found in many Italian cities. Will certainly be back !

The pizza was delicious, the very best quality in ingredients. Ambient is very cozy. Although as a popular place you usually have to wait during the dinner. So take in consideration 20 min to get inside. The place is very cool bus portions are small, not the usual size you re used to in Milano. As well is it expensive for the size mentioned. Despite this, I will definitely recommend it for a different experience and a high quality pizza.

Very good Neapolitan pizza, with natural ingredients. What I didn't like is that you can't book a table, and you may spend an hour or two waiting in the queue if not getting there early enough for the time of an Italian dinner. Staff very warm and nice.
